This Week's Notable Releases: In a Lonely Place, Bob Hope, and The Manhattan Project
Another banner week for DVDs with the studios releasing some great films and boxed sets such as:
In a Lonely Place [review] - this Humphrey Bogart feature is an excellent film, a thriller with plenty of romance and drama that really benefits from some great performances and impressively tight direction by Nicholas Ray; and Entertaining the Troops: Bob Hope [review] - Time-Life presents three Bob Hope USO Christmas tours- two during the Vietnam War in 1969 and 1970 and one from 1951 during the Korean War; and The Manhattan Project [review] - a fun watch, an entertaining mix of effective comedy and solid suspense done with a decidedly ‘eighties' style.

New Reviews: A Fine Pair, A Prayer for the Dying, and Melinda
Our reviewers have been busy this week, filling the DVD
Talk Review Database more great entries. Some new reviews of note include:
A Fine Pair - Rock Hudson and Claudia Cardinale are the unlikely couple at the center of the romantic caper comedy that is silly fun; A Prayer for the Dying - Director Mike Hodges' film is a modern western with some moments of explosive action and a characteristically moody Mickey Rourke in the lead; and Melinda - for fans of '70s blaxploitation, this is a must-see... great performances and assured writing and direction make this a cut above typical grindhouse fare.
